SCHWELLENBACH, J.

Renee Pamela Crozier was born in Modesto, California, August 11, 1949, as the lawful issue of William "Bud" Crozier and Ruth Crozier, his wife. They have two other children, who are older than Renee. Shortly after Renee's birth, the family moved to Seattle, where they resided with Mrs. Edith Kogenhop, the husband's sister.
